NCT ID: NCT01226264 Active, not recruiting - Recurrence Clinical Trials

Diffusion MRI; Predictive Value for Cervical Uterine Cancer Recurrence

s52647
Start date: November 2010
Phase: N/A
Study type: Interventional

Uterine cervical cancer is the second most common female malignancy. Therapy monitoring is essential to detect early recurrence. Diffusion-weighted magnetic resonance imaging is an emerging MRI imaging technique which has a potential value for the detection of primary and recurrent disease and for the assessment of response to therapy. The purpose of this project is to evaluate the predictive value of DWI during and after therapy in the prediction of recurrence of cervical uterine cancer. It will be considered whether DWI is able to provide early information about the response to therapy. This could enable the identification of less- or non-responsive tumors and in this way therapy can be adapted as soon as possible. Hence the investigators could offer the patient a more efficient treatment scheme and a reduction in toxicity related to the treatment could be established.

NCT ID: NCT01200992 Terminated - Bladder Neoplasm Clinical Trials

Efficacy and Safety Evaluation of EN3348 (Mycobacterial Cell Wall-DNA Complex [MCC]) as Compared With Mitomycin C in the Intravesical Treatment of Subjects With BCG Recurrent/Refractory Non-muscle Invasive Bladder Cancer

EMBARC-RF
Start date: November 2010
Phase: Phase 3
Study type: Interventional

This is a phase 3 randomized, active-controlled, open-label, multicenter study that will be conducted in approximately 120 investigational sites worldwide. Subjects with either recurrent or refractory NMIBC (Ta high grade, T1 low or high grade, CIS) will be eligible for participation in this study. Refractory disease is defined as evidence of persistent high grade bladder cancer (Ta HG, T1, and/or CIS) at least 6 months from the start of a full induction course of BCG with or without maintenance/re-treatment at 3 months. Recurrent disease is defined as reappearance of disease after achieving a tumor-free status by 6 months following a full induction course of BCG with or without maintenance/re-treatment at 3 months. Subjects with recurrent disease must have recurred within 18 months following the last dose of BCG. Approximately 450 subjects will be randomized. The primary objective of this study is to evaluate the efficacy of intravesical EN3348 as compared with mitomycin C in the treatment of subjects with recurrent or refractory NMIBC. The secondary objective is to evaluate the safety of EN3348 as compared with mitomycin C in the treatment of subjects with BCG recurrent or refractory NMIBC. This study will consist of 4 phases: Screening, Induction, Maintenance and Follow-Up and will be conducted over 3 years.

NCT ID: NCT01198704 Completed - Clinical trials for Hepatocellular Carcinoma

Study of Factors Predicting Tumor Recurrence After Liver Transplantation for Hepatocellular Carcinoma (HCC)

EFAPRE
Start date: January 2009
Phase:
Study type: Observational

Results of liver transplantation, the best theoretical treatment for HCC, are limited by tumor recurrence. In order to limit this risk Milan criteria was proposed in 1996. However, these criteria are to restrictive and approximately 40% of patients denied by Milan criteria may be cured by liver transplantation. The purpose of this study was thus to prospectively evaluate factors predicting tumor recurrence after liver transplantation for HCC and then to reassess criteria for liver transplantation.

NCT ID: NCT01193842 Completed - HIV Infection Clinical Trials

Vorinostat and Combination Chemotherapy With Rituximab in Treating Patients With HIV-Related Diffuse Large B-Cell Non-Hodgkin Lymphoma or Other Aggressive B-Cell Lymphomas

Start date: October 6, 2010
Phase: Phase 1/Phase 2
Study type: Interventional

This partially randomized phase I/II trial studies the side effects and the best dose of vorinostat when given together with combination chemotherapy and rituximab to see how well it works compared to combination chemotherapy alone in treating patients with human immunodeficiency virus-related diffuse large B-cell non-Hodgkin lymphoma or other aggressive B-cell lymphomas. Vorinostat may stop the growth of cancer cells by blocking some of the enzymes needed for cell growth. Drugs used in chemotherapy work in different ways to stop the growth of cancer cells, either by killing the cells, by stopping them from dividing, or by stopping them from spreading. Monoclonal antibodies, such as rituximab, may interfere with the ability of cancer cells to grow and spread. Giving vorinostat together with combination chemotherapy and rituximab may kill more cancer cells.

NCT ID: NCT01178021 Completed - Vivax Malaria Clinical Trials

Estimating the Risk of Plasmodium Vivax Relapses in Afghanistan

VRA
Start date: August 2009
Phase: Phase 4
Study type: Interventional

This is an open label two-arm randomized prospective study of two treatments for P. vivax malaria. Patients meeting study inclusion criteria will be enrolled and allocated either chloroquine alone or chloroquine plus primaquine (0.25mg/kg/day for 14 days). Patients will be followed-up for 1 year, with clinical and laboratory examinations at each visit. Patients with recurrent P. vivax infection will be treated with the same medication as initially randomized unless contraindicated. Recurrences in the two arms will be compared to estimate the risk of and mean duration to relapse, classify the relapse pattern as early or late relapse and to estimate the efficacy and safety of the study drugs. Polymerase Chain Reaction (PCR) analysis will be used as far as possible help to distinguish between relapse and re-infection. Samples for chloroquine pharmacokinetic analysis will be collected on day 7 from each study subject as well as on the day of recurrence if within 8 weeks of chloroquine
